Faith in Focus is the magazine of the Reformed Churches of New Zealand. We are a federation of 17 Churches here in both the North and South Islands of New Zealand. In the 1950s immigrants from Holland were unable to find a comfortable ecclesiastical home in their new land. The theological stance of the mainline Presbyterian Church was too far removed from the theology of the great creeds of the Reformation. The Reformed churches began with the four subordinate standards - the Belgic confession, the Canons of Dort, the Heidelberg Catechism and the Westminster Confession. Almost immediately a regular magazine was produced and evolved into what is today the Faith in Focus. The magazine, with its adherence to the Biblical theology re-discovered at the time of the great 16th Century Reformation, seeks to promote Reformed thinking as it applies to all areas of life. We publish articles that are theological in nature as well as on pastoral subjects and on general areas of Christian living. Children and adults are catered for.
